Why the classification sticks

Ingestible products carry regulatory and liability exposure; the category has a long record of trial-offer and negative-option disputes; and most sales are card-not-present and recurring. That combination sits at the high end of expected chargebacks on the networks, so acquiring banks price and underwrite accordingly. An honest brand inherits the vertical's history at application time and earns its way out with data.

The application, from the underwriter's chair

The underwriter opens your website and tries to buy something. They check whether the recurring term is disclosed before checkout, whether the refund policy is findable, whether the label makes disease claims, and whether the descriptor the customer will see on their statement matches the brand. California's Automatic Renewal Law requires clear and conspicuous disclosure of renewal terms, affirmative consent, a written acknowledgment to the customer, and a cancellation method at least as easy as enrollment. Card network rules for recurring and trial-to-paid billing add their own requirements, including advance reminders and receipts. Build the subscription on a recurring billing platform that handles reminders, tokenized card storage, retries and one-click cancellation, and have counsel review the checkout language. This is not the place for a homemade cron job.

Chargeback control for shipped consumables

Monitoring programs begin around 0.9%-1% of transactions. A subscription brand with several thousand monthly rebills can cross that on "I forgot" disputes alone. Practical levers: a descriptor that names the brand, a pre-rebill email, fast refunds on request, tracked shipping with delivery confirmation, and fraud detection that catches stolen-card orders before they ship. Chargeback alert services that let you refund before the dispute posts pay for themselves in this category.

Reserves, pricing and the review

New supplement accounts open with a rolling reserve and pricing above mainstream retail; both loosen after months of low disputes and refunds. Get the review date in writing. Cards settle in 1-2 business days after the reserve is netted, so model cash flow on that from the start.

Wholesale and local retail

Many Santa Barbara and Ventura brands also sell to yoga studios, gyms, surf shops and health stores from Goleta to Thousand Oaks. Those invoices belong on ACH, which settles in 1-3 business days and stays off the consumer card ratio. Keeping wholesale and consumer channels on separate accounts prevents one large wholesale refund from skewing the numbers on the subscription account.

Growing without losing the account

Tell the processor before launching a new offer, a new product category or a new site. Never run a free-trial funnel without legal review. Track disputes and refunds weekly. Brands that do this keep their accounts through growth; brands that surprise their processor tend to lose them at the worst time.
